I had a very disappointing experience with Moss Electric in Wichita Falls. Julian chose not to call me or work with me on the below issue. From the start, I clearly communicated the scope of work: replace an existing Tesla charger setup with a NEMA 14-50 outlet and reuse the existing 60-amp breaker. This was not a complex install—most of the infrastructure was already in place from a prior installation. Despite that, their technicians arrived and installed the wrong outlet (6-50) without consulting me. This is not what I requested and left me unable to use my equipment. One of the technicians even admitted they were not informed of the correct outlet type, which reflects poor internal communication. Because of their mistake, they had to make additional trips and corrections—yet I was still charged as if the delays and extra work were my responsibility. To make matters worse, they sent two electricians for a straightforward residential job, significantly increasing labor costs without prior approval. The final invoice was roughly 3x higher than expected, and it was sent three months after the work was completed, with no upfront pricing transparency. At no point was I informed that bringing two technicians would impact the cost this significantly. They also advertise a military discount, but there was no meaningful cost consideration reflected in the final bill. To be clear: * I specified the correct outlet (14-50) upfront * The wrong outlet was installed without approval * Additional trips were required due to their error * Labor was inflated by sending two electricians unnecessarily * Pricing was not disclosed in advance * Invoice was delayed by months This experience felt disorganized, overpriced, and lacking accountability. I would not recommend Moss Electric based on this experience. ——-break for response—— Thank you for the response. I want to clarify a few points so future customers have an accurate understanding of what occurred. I clearly requested a NEMA 14-50 outlet to replace an existing Tesla charging setup. Regardless of any NEC considerations around breaker sizing, installing a 6-50 outlet without confirmation was not appropriate and did not match the agreed scope of work. If there were concerns about code compliance or inability to reach me, the correct course of action would have been to pause—not proceed with a different installation. Regarding communication, I promptly returned all calls and all text messages which I have proof of, including T-Mobile billing. I was not made aware that two technicians would be used or that this would significantly increase labor costs. While I respect safety practices, pricing transparency is a basic expectation, especially when it materially impacts the final bill. Additionally, the need for multiple trips was the result of installing the wrong outlet initially—not due to faulty equipment on my end. Charging the customer for time spent correcting that error is not consistent with standard professional practice. Finally, the invoice was received months after the work was completed, and there was no clear estimate provided upfront. That lack of transparency contributed significantly to the frustration with this experience. To be clear, my concern is not about code compliance or safety, those are important, but about communication, execution, and accountability. I stand by my original review.
